WebJul 16, 2024 · The IRS just announced a key valuation amount for 2024. The maximum value of an employer-provided vehicle (including cars, vans and trucks) first made available to employees for personal use in calendar year 2024 for which either the vehicle cents-per-mile valuation rule or fleet-average valuation rule may be used is $50,400.
